All About Max Winkler. The states property crime rate has remained relatively steady since 2008, despite a 5% uptick in 2020 compared to the average of the prior three years. Colorados violent crime rate of 423 crimes per 100,000 people in 2020 was the 20th-highest in the U.S. Alaska recorded a rate of 838 violent crimes per 100,000 people the highest in the country. Data shows that the states increase in violent crime is primarily driven by the increase in the rate of aggravated assaults, which rose 18% in 2020 over the three-year average. Both Aurora and Denver saw their homicide rates rise 50% over the three-year average and Colorado Springs rate rose 33%. There was a near 30% surge in homicides in the United States in 2020, the largest one-year increase ever recorded. Rates of violent crime and property crime for Colorado and its three largest cities remain lower than those recorded during a nationwide crime explosion in the early 1990s. Per-capita crime rates the number of incidents per 100,000 people are important to understanding trends in Colorado because they allow more relevant comparisons over time as the states population has grown. Colorado Springs property crime rate, however, has remained steady since approximately 2005 and declined between 2019 and 2020. Colorados pattern of rising homicides, aggravated assaults and motor vehicle thefts match national trends from 2020. Denver and Auroras historical crime trends also mirror the national pattern 2020s violent crime rates are about equal to those recorded in the early 1990s, though lower than record highs.
